What are they? Yellow and red cards are used as a means to discipline players for misconduct during the game. A yellow card is used to caution players, while a red card results in the player’s dismissal from the field of play. Thus, yellow cards are used to punish milder forms of misconduct than red cards.

Where do referees write on yellow cards?

What do refs write on yellow cards? The ref writes the player’s number and team on the back of the card. This is a record of the offense so that the ref knows later on in the game in case the player gets another yellow.

What color card does the referee issue if a player is to be disqualified removed from the game?

red card
In association football, a red card is shown by a referee to signify that a player has been sent off. A player who has been sent off is required to leave the field of play immediately and must take no further part in the game.

What do referee write on yellow card?

When a player is cautioned (shown the yellow card) or sent out of the game (shown the red card), the Referee notes: the player’s identity (name or team&number), the misconduct reason and (probably) the actual act, and. the match time.

What if goalkeeper gets red card?

If a team’s goalkeeper receives a red card another player is required to assume goalkeeping duties, so teams usually substitute another goalkeeper for an outfield player if they still have substitutes available. Law 12 of the Laws of the Game lists the categories of misconduct for which a player may be sent off.

What happens when you get a yellow card?

The Yellow Card In essence, a yellow card is given as a caution or warning. It provides players receiving them another chance to stay on the field for the remainder of the game, whereas a red card means that the player has to leave the pitch with immediate effect.
